Muse Mirrored Side Table – a decorative pedestal for elegant interiors
The Muse mirrored side table is a distinctive interior accent that combines the practical function of an occasional table with the sculptural presence of a decorative pedestal. Its cylindrical silhouette is covered with individually arranged sections of mirrored glass, creating a faceted surface that reflects light, colour and surrounding details from different angles.
Measuring 47 x 47 x 61.5 cm, the table has tall, balanced proportions that make it particularly well suited to positioning beside a sofa, armchair or statement chair. It may also be used as an elegant plinth for displaying a sculptural lamp, vase, decorative bowl or carefully selected objet. The design is intended for interiors where accessories are chosen with the same attention to material and proportion as the principal pieces of furniture.
Constructed from iron and mirrored glass, the Muse table weighs 15 kg, giving it a substantial and considered presence. Its reflective finish introduces light and movement without relying on bold colour, allowing the table to complement a wide range of refined interior palettes.

Product details
Product name: Muse
Product type: mirrored side table / decorative pedestal
Colour: mirrored
Materials: mirrored glass and iron
Width: 47 cm
Depth: 47 cm
Height: 61.5 cm
Weight: 15 kg
